The not too long ago signed Gaza Peace Agreement is a “landmark” step in direction of stability within the Middle East, India has stated, reiterating {that a} two-state answer stays “the one pragmatic path” to attaining sturdy peace between Israel and Palestine.

Speaking on the United Nations Security Council’s quarterly open debate on the state of affairs within the Middle East on Thursday (October 24, 2025), India’s Permanent Representative to the UN, Ambassador Parvathaneni Harish, stated, “It is India’s earnest want to grasp the imaginative and prescient of a secure and peaceable Middle East… deprivation and indignity can’t be a part of every day life; civilians should not die on account of battle.”

India stands totally able to contribute to this endeavour, he stated.

Mr. Harish stated New Delhi hoped the “constructive diplomatic momentum” generated by the peace summit in Sharm el-Sheikh earlier this month would result in “lasting peace within the area”.

Welcoming the signing of the “landmark” peace deal, the envoy lauded the U.S., “particularly” President Donald Trump, for enjoying an instrumental position in forging the deal, and in addition recommended Egypt and Qatar for his or her contributions.

The Ambassador recalled that for the reason that October 7, 2023 battle, India had persistently condemned terrorism, referred to as for an finish to civilian struggling, demanded the discharge of hostages, and harassed the necessity for unimpeded humanitarian support to Gaza.

He stated India considered the brand new peace settlement as “an enabler and a catalyst” for these goals.

“The short-term features of the current diplomatic outcomes should pave the best way for medium- to long-term political commitments and sensible motion on the bottom in direction of the realisation of a two-state answer,” he stated.

Underscoring India’s help for the Palestinian individuals’s proper to self-determination, the envoy referred to final month’s UN high-level convention on implementing the two-state answer, saying it had “underlined the best way ahead”.

On the humanitarian entrance, Mr. Harish famous that India had prolonged over $170 million in complete help to Palestine, together with $40 million price of ongoing initiatives and 135 metric tons of medicines and aid provides prior to now two years.

“Palestinian individuals can’t rebuild their lives with out the help of the worldwide group,” he stated, calling for the creation of financial frameworks conducive to funding and employment.

“Peace and calm on the Palestinian entrance have implications for the broader area… Talks should proceed and there should be abiding religion within the efficacy of dialogue and diplomacy,” Mr. Harish stated.

Mr. Harish additionally touched upon broader regional points, together with Syria, Lebanon, and Yemen, underlining India’s persevering with humanitarian and peacekeeping contributions.

On Syria, he reaffirmed India’s backing for a “Syrian-led, Syrian-owned political course of” and paid tribute to Brigadier General Amitabh Jha, who was killed whereas serving as Acting Force Commander of the United Nations Disengagement Observer Force (UNDOF) in December 2024.

India is the third-largest troop contributor to UNDOF.

He additionally harassed the security of UN peacekeepers in Lebanon, the place India is the second-largest contributor to UNIFIL (United Nations Interim Force in Lebanon), and expressed hope that the Lebanese Armed Forces would quickly take full management as soon as the mission’s sundown clause takes impact in 2026.

Mr. Harish additionally referred to as for an “instant cessation of hostilities” in Yemen to permit humanitarian support to achieve civilians, saying such help “should be above politics”.
